diff options
author | Guillaume Horel | 2018-03-18 11:24:21 -0400 |
---|---|---|
committer | Guillaume Horel | 2018-03-18 11:24:21 -0400 |
commit | 409500c848b500cf7616df1f839bbc0ee97ff0b5 (patch) | |
tree | 7ee1c3f723df05856bf3d4758a89a52749a3629c | |
parent | 27a86eae31dc48e2a629f57292b9f8f7bc60afca (diff) | |
download | aur-409500c848b500cf7616df1f839bbc0ee97ff0b5.tar.gz |
add minizip-git dependency
-rw-r--r-- | .SRCINFO | 5 | ||||
-rw-r--r-- | PKGBUILD | 17 | ||||
-rw-r--r-- | find_minizip.patch | 11 |
3 files changed, 27 insertions, 6 deletions
@@ -1,6 +1,6 @@ pkgbase = linphone-desktop-git pkgdesc = A Voice-over-IP phone - pkgver = 4.1.1.r253.g986f5d99 + pkgver = 4.1.1.r288.g352e4985 pkgrel = 1 url = http://www.linphone.org arch = i686 @@ -21,6 +21,7 @@ pkgbase = linphone-desktop-git depends = libpulse depends = libxv depends = mediastreamer-git + depends = minizip-git depends = ortp-git depends = libsoup depends = libnotify @@ -33,7 +34,9 @@ pkgbase = linphone-desktop-git conflicts = linphone-desktop options = !emptydirs source = git+https://github.com/BelledonneCommunications/linphone-desktop.git + source = find_minizip.patch sha256sums = SKIP + sha256sums = fe74b28500f73e81886f052f41e8946bac170249760f5fe694e96c4d75e0ed73 pkgname = linphone-desktop-git @@ -2,29 +2,36 @@ pkgname=linphone-desktop-git _pkgname=linphone-desktop -pkgver=4.1.1.r253.g986f5d99 +pkgver=4.1.1.r288.g352e4985 pkgrel=1 pkgdesc="A Voice-over-IP phone" arch=('i686' 'x86_64') url="http://www.linphone.org" license=('GPL') depends=('bcg729-git' 'belcard-git' 'belle-sip-git' 'belr-git' 'bzrtp-git' - 'linphone-git' 'libpulse' 'libxv' 'mediastreamer-git' 'ortp-git' - 'libsoup' 'libnotify' 'qt5-svg' + 'linphone-git' 'libpulse' 'libxv' 'mediastreamer-git' 'minizip-git' + 'ortp-git' 'libsoup' 'libnotify' 'qt5-svg' 'qt5-quickcontrols2' 'qt5-graphicaleffects' 'qt5-tools') makedepends=('cmake' 'graphviz' 'intltool' 'pkg-config' 'python-pystache' 'perl-xml-parser') optdepends=('pulseaudio') options=('!emptydirs') provides=('linphone-desktop') conflicts=('linphone-desktop') -source=("git+https://github.com/BelledonneCommunications/linphone-desktop.git") -sha256sums=('SKIP') +source=("git+https://github.com/BelledonneCommunications/linphone-desktop.git" + "find_minizip.patch") +sha256sums=('SKIP' + 'fe74b28500f73e81886f052f41e8946bac170249760f5fe694e96c4d75e0ed73') pkgver() { cd "${srcdir}/${_pkgname}" git describe --long --tags | sed 's/\([^-]*-g\)/r\1/; s/-/./g' } +prepare() { + cd $srcdir + patch -p0 < ../find_minizip.patch +} + build() { cd $_pkgname cmake -DCMAKE_INSTALL_PREFIX=/usr \ diff --git a/find_minizip.patch b/find_minizip.patch new file mode 100644 index 000000000000..58608d2f97c7 --- /dev/null +++ b/find_minizip.patch @@ -0,0 +1,11 @@ +diff -urN linphone-desktop-orig/cmake/FindMinizip.cmake linphone-desktop/cmake/FindMinizip.cmake +--- linphone-desktop-orig/cmake/FindMinizip.cmake 2018-03-18 11:08:14.925958855 -0400 ++++ linphone-desktop/cmake/FindMinizip.cmake 2018-03-18 11:08:34.051130410 -0400 +@@ -37,7 +37,6 @@ + + find_library(MINIZIP_LIBRARIES + NAMES minizip minizipd +- NO_CMAKE_SYSTEM_PATH + ) + + include(FindPackageHandleStandardArgs) |